The days of simply paying electricity bills and calling it a day are long gone. Today, successful businesses work hand in hand with energy brokers who act as the middlemen between retailers and consumers, securing the most competitive energy deals in the market. These professionals not only compare rates but also assess the business’s energy usage patterns, ensuring that you’re not overpaying or stuck in unfavorable contracts.

But there’s more to the story than just lower prices. Cost savings are just the tip of the iceberg. Smart businesses are going a step further by collaborating with experienced energy professionals who bring strategic insights to the table. These experts help organizations build long-term energy strategies that align with business objectives. That includes not only choosing the right suppliers but also analyzing consumption data and recommending actionable solutions for greater efficiency.

One of the unsung heroes in this equation is the electricity broker, often working behind the scenes but making a tremendous impact on your bottom line. A good broker doesn’t just chase the cheapest rates — they look at contract flexibility, green energy options, and your risk exposure based on market conditions. In essence, they become an extension of your team, invested in your success.

Businesses serious about optimization often engage an energy efficiency consultant. These specialists conduct detailed energy audits, identify wastage, and suggest improvements such as upgrading equipment, implementing automation systems, or shifting to renewable energy sources. What sets them apart is their ability to translate complex energy data into simple, actionable steps that deliver measurable outcomes.

As the global shift towards greener operations accelerates, there’s also growing demand for sustainability consulting. More than a feel-good initiative, sustainability strategies have become central to risk management and brand positioning. Consultants in this space guide companies through carbon accounting, green certifications, and ESG reporting — all of which are increasingly being scrutinized by investors and consumers alike.

For larger enterprises or companies managing multiple facilities, a commercial energy broker can be indispensable. These brokers specialize in high-volume energy needs and offer customized procurement strategies. Their understanding of the commercial landscape enables them to negotiate better terms, leverage bulk purchasing power, and create energy portfolios that align with operational goals.

All of these roles work best when integrated into a comprehensive energy management approach. This isn’t just about cutting costs — it’s about gaining visibility and control over how energy flows through your business. With the right analytics tools, you can identify anomalies, prevent inefficiencies, and make data-backed decisions that lead to continuous improvement.
